Was at 'Billie's' (aka Gossips) too, though not quite the same magic as Crackers.Remember Cameo's 'Sound Table' & Webster Lewis's 'El Bobo' being played there as newly released imports;just golden memories. Long live the original 'Inner London Disco/Boogie' scene @ Crackers, Gossips,Spats, Whisky A Go Go,Monkberrys. Central London has just never been the same since those halcyon days of the late 70s & early 80s.Classic music,cool people, quality dancing, & just great memories allround.
Also Sunday Nights at Crackers, wardour St. At that time Gossips was called Billies, when Crackers closed we started going to Billies on a Saturday afternoon, same DJ's... Big Up George Powers & Crew.
